The FDC2214RGHR is a high-performance capacitance-to-digital converter from Texas Instruments that offers a specialized solution for sensing and measurement applications. This innovative component is designed to accurately detect and measure capacitance changes in various environments, making it ideal for creating touch-sensitive user interfaces, level sensing in non-conductive materials, or even for proximity sensing.
Key Features
- High Resolution: The device boasts a high-resolution 28-bit measurement, ensuring precise detection of small changes in capacitance.
- Noise Immunity: It features active shielding for excellent noise immunity, which is critical for stable and reliable operation in electrically noisy environments.
- Multi-Channel: With up to 4-channel input, the FDC2214RGHR can manage multiple sensors simultaneously, making it versatile for complex applications.
- Low Power Consumption: Designed for power-sensitive applications, it operates with low current consumption, which is essential for battery-operated devices.

Technical Specifications
| Parameter |
Value |
| Resolution |
28-bit |
| Input Channels |
4 |
| Supply Voltage |
2.7V to 3.6V |
| Interface |
I2C |
| Package |
QFN-16 |
